LYNDALL D. MCDANIEL, Appellant v. JESSY DALE SMITH, Appellee


On Appeal from the County Court at Law No. 1 Hunt County, Texas
Trial Court Cause No. CC1300047

ORDER

By letter dated May 21, 2015, the Court questioned its jurisdiction over this appeal noting that the clerk's record included a motion advising the trial court that the March 17, 2015 summary judgment order that is the subject of this appeal does not dispose of all pending claims and parties in the case. In response to the Court's letter, appellant has moved to abate the appeal pending a June 25, 2015 hearing in the trial court on appellant's motion to dispose of or sever the remaining claims in the case. We GRANT the motion and ABATE the appeal pending further order of the Court.

We ORDER appellant to file a status report on or before July 3, 2015. We caution appellant that failure to timely file the required status report will result in reinstatement and dismissal of the case.
